KlutterAI is an AI expense tracker for iOS and Android to capture receipts, organize spending, track budgets, surface recurring charges, and export reports.
KlutterAI is an AI-powered expense tracker designed to help people record spending, organize receipts, and monitor money habits from a mobile app. The homepage presents it as a tool for moving from manual expense logging to a more automated workflow based on scanning, syncing, and categorizing transactions and receipts.
Its core workflow centers on capturing bills or receipts, turning them into structured expense records, and then using that data to surface budgets, recurring charges, spending patterns, forecasts, and alerts. The product is positioned for people who want a clearer view of where money goes without relying on spreadsheets or manual data entry.

KlutterAI is presented as an AI-powered expense tracker. The homepage says you can download it for iOS or Android, but it does not clearly document web app support on the pages provided.
The site says you can upload a bill or snap a photo of a receipt, and the AI will read, digitize, and categorize the expense. It also mentions linking email and SMS to see expenses in one view.
The homepage says KlutterAI can auto-detect recurring payments and subscriptions, generate custom reports and CSV exports, set budgets, and send intelligent alerts for unusual spending or new recurring bills.
The site lists download links for iOS and Android. Those are the only platform-specific apps explicitly mentioned in the source content.
A help center page is available, and it lists a contact phone number and support email. The pricing and contact pages currently shown in the source return page-not-found errors.
